> Subject: [PATCH v2 1/2] dt-bindings: Add binding for Renesas 8T49N241
>
> Renesas 8T49N241 has 4 outputs, 1 integral and 3 fractional dividers.
> The 8T49N241 accepts up to two differential or single-ended input clocks
> and a fundamental-mode crystal input. The internal PLL can lock to either
> of the input reference clocks or to the crystal to behave as a frequency
> synthesizer.

> +title: Binding for Renesas 8T49N241 Universal Frequency Translator
> +
> +description: |
> + The 8T49N241 has one fractional-feedback PLL that can be used as a
> + jitter attenuator and frequency translator. It is equipped with one
> + integer and three fractional output dividers, allowing the generation
> + of up to four different output frequencies, ranging from 8kHz to 1GHz.
> + These frequencies are completely independent of each other, the input
> + reference frequencies and the crystal reference frequency. The device
> + places virtually no constraints on input to output frequency
> +conversion,
> + supporting all FEC rates, including the new revision of ITU-T
> + Recommendation G.709 (2009), most with 0ppm conversion error.
> + The outputs may select among LVPECL, LVDS, HCSL or LVCMOS output
> levels.
> +
> + The driver can read a full register map from the DT, and will use
> + that register map to initialize the attached part (via I2C) when the
> + system boots. Any configuration not supported by the common clock
> + framework must be done via the full register map, including optimized
> settings.
> +
> + The 8T49N241 accepts up to two differential or single-ended input
> + clocks and a fundamental-mode crystal input. The internal PLL can
> + lock to either of the input reference clocks or just to the crystal
> + to behave as a frequency synthesizer. The PLL can use the second
> + input for redundant backup of the primary input reference, but in
> + this case, both input clock references must be related in frequency.
> +
> + All outputs are currently assumed to be LVDS, unless overridden in
> + the full register map in the DT.
